EDITORS COMMENTS
Are these the long-lost bones of legendary British explorer Percy Fawcett? In this poignant image from 1951, Percy's son Brian carefully examines a skull discovered in South America, the very place where his father and his expedition team vanished without a trace in 1925. The enigma of Percy Fawcett's disappearance has captivated the world for decades, with theories ranging from death by natural causes to being sacrificed by indigenous tribes. Brian Fawcett, a Colonel in the British Army like his father, was part of the search parties organized to find his father after the news of his disappearance reached the public. The search proved fruitless, but the mystery of Percy Fawcett's fate continued to haunt his family. Years later, in the 1950s, this skull was presented to Brian, raising renewed hopes that it might be the remains of his father. The examination of the skull was a deeply personal and emotional moment for Brian, as he sought answers to the question that had haunted him for over three decades. The image captures the intensity of his focus, as he carefully studies the skull, seeking clues to the truth. The search for Percy Fawcett remains an enduring tale of adventure, mystery, and the human spirit's unyielding desire to explore the unknown. This photograph serves as a poignant reminder of the ongoing quest for answers and the profound impact that the enigma of Percy Fawcett's disappearance continues to have on us.
